describe the structure of nucleus

A
  • Nucleus is a double membrane called the envelope containing ~3000 nuclear pores
    that enables molecules to enter and leave. It also contains chromatin and a nucleolus
    which is the site of ribosome production.

A granular jelly like material called
nucleoplasm makes up the bulk of the nucleus.

describe the structure of mitochondria

A

Mitochondria are oval shaped, bound by a double membrane called the envelope.
The inner membrane is folded to form projections called cristae with a matrix on the inside
containing all the enzymes needed for respiration.

what is co-transport

A

occurs when two substances are simultaneously transported across a membrane

This occurs particularly in epithelial cells of the ileum.
